The above Pictures do not really do the Intake Manifold justice. All were from a crappy Cell Phone. It has yet to be fully cleaned up. The exterior has yet to be Polished to the full luster, Only an initial 5 minute buffing has taken place. That is what you see in the last 5 pictures.
The final piece will be fully polished with no scratches or blemishes.
The Intake has already been fully ported and polished on the inside of the plenum, and fully inside the runners. All corners have been radiused, no burrs, no scuffs to cause any obstructions. The Plenium is 5 inch D shaped which is the best of the best shape, the Runners are 2.25 inch Oval shaped which are also the ideal shape and size for full engine potential. I fabbed this first one for the stock Throttle body but can easily change it (for nominal fee) out for larger TB if buyer so chooses. All vacuum lines/fittings will also be attached and the Intake will be ready to bolt up with minimal install work. The vacuum block will be on the underside to hide all the lines out of site. I didn't see provisions for the EGR and the MAP sensor on this intake manifold. The EGR I can understand. Is it the responsibility of the buyer to make the necessary modifications for the MAP sensor? Also, is the EGR port blocked off on the flange?

Map sensor is located on firewall side of the manifold just barely out of view(not pictured cuz it wasnt on at the time of pictures same with vacuum lines) and egr has been blocked off.
*edit, egr hasnt been blocked offyet , its open as of right now, would be block/filled or connected depending on buyer.

Did you guys use a CNC'd MAP adapter or just drill and tap the provisions for the MAP sensor? Also, probably worth noting that since the EGR will be removed that the buyer will need to make arrangements to disable/bypass the CEL to be able to pass emissions with this manifold.

At the time of the above pictures the Vacuum block had yet to be welded into position. Since then I have fabbed up a block and TIG welded it to the back side of the plenum. That location was chosen to hide all the lines. I have also Drilled out/Tapped for vacuum fittings and the MAP sensor. As for the Map Sensor I tried to mimic the OEM mount. I also added brackets to hold the fuel rail firmly in place. The Intake is ready for sale at this point. I have tried to design the Intake so that the end user/buyer would have minimal install.
